I noticed a message which pointed the reader towards something on Facebook.

There are some serious unresolved privacy issues with Facebook: one is that
it looks like they 'own' the data you put there, in perpetuity; Facebook
doesn't really work if you use a false name; and governments (our own in
particular) want to have access to it.

I don't want to start a debate about it - it just seems to me to be a bit of
a dodgy place to 'get active' for these reasons.
